Ingredients
The following ingredients have 12 Servings
- 1 Raw Mango (large)
- 2 tsp Salt
- 2 tbsp Red chili powder
- 1 tsp Menthiya powder / Fenugreek powder
- 3 tbsp Oil (Sesame oil)
- 1/4 tsp Asafetida
- 1/2 tsp Mustard seeds
Instruction
- Select firm raw mango with no visible blemishes or injuries to the surface. Clean it well and cut it in to tiny pieces with the skin on. You could go right in until you reach the seed and cut up all the flesh.
- Dry roast the fenugreek seeds and grind it into a powder and keep aside.
- Add the cut mango pieces in a wide bowl and to this add the red chili powder, fenugreek powder, salt and asafetida. Do not mix at this stage, just pile up all the spices in the center.
- Heat oil and to this add the mustard seeds. Once the seeds sputter, add the hot oil to the mango bowl right on to the piled up spices. The hot oil will sort of fry the spices and make them aromatic.
- Now mix everything well and store in an airtight container.
